[12][13] Its research and impact assessments on the negotiation, structure, enforcement, and effects of international economic agreements feature in public policy debates.

[14][15][16][17] Notable faculty include Manfred Elsig, Joseph Francois, Peter Van den Bossche, Thomas Cottier, Michael Hahn.

[20] Some of the professors are part of the editorial board of the World Trade Review, an academic peer-reviewed journal in the field of economic law, which was created as an initiative of the WTO.

[21] Degrees earned at the WTI are awarded by the University of Bern,[22] and are regulated under Swiss law governing higher education.

[25] The WTI is a sponsor of the John H. Jackson Moot Court,[26] the Model WTO at the University of St.Gallen,[27] and a member of UNCTAD's Virtual Institute.
